Rating: 5 out of 5 stars - Good Transfer to DVD (Widescreen Collector's Edition (2 discs))
The opinions presented in the various reviews regarding the quality of the transfer of this (1987) film to DVD span the full range from horrible to excellent. My comments are based on the 2-disc "Widescreen Collector's Edition" of "Predator". The format of this edition is anamorphic widescreen which was also enhanced for 16 x 9 aspect ratio screens since the picture fills the entire TV screen.

For the most part, the transfer of sound and picture is excellent. The only problem is that the video transfer is not consistently excellent. Most of the scences look crystal sharp with great color on my large-screen, high-definition LCD TV (played on a Toshiba 1080p HD DVD player--the "upconversion" helps)--but then there are short segments (a few seconds here and there) where the image becomes suddenly quite grainy--but, since most of these grainy segments are night scences, the problem is not too obvious. Most of the night scenes, however, are crystal clear and sharp with fantastic contrast. Luckily, the grainy segments are very brief in duration and do not really detract from the overall entertainment value of the movie.

Nonetheless, this exciting, suspenseful, classic Arnold film deserves a high-definition remastering.
